Stolen from De Stijl
STOLEN FROM DE STIJL — Inspired by the structures, colour palettes, techniques and textures of work by members of the Dutch De Stijl movement of the 1920’s, including Theo Van Doesburg, Gerrit Rietveld and Piet Mondrian — Darkroom have brought to life this Modernist movement for today’s audience. Hand printed canvas is chopped up and sewn into 3 dimensional cushion sculptures, or used in the body of the signature Darkroom leather-handled tote bags. The hard edged, geometric shapes become fluid and abstracted when printed onto fine guage wool scarves. Beautifully crafted hand-bound books sit alongside hand painted, oversize ceramic plates can be used on the table or as decorative wall hangings.
